A Nurse-Led Intervention for Fear of Progression in Advanced Cancer

Running, not enrolling · Not applicable

Conditions studied: Advanced Lung Carcinoma, Metastatic Malignant Female Reproductive System Neoplasm, Stage III Lung Cancer AJCC v8, Stage IIIA Lung Cancer AJCC v8, Stage IIIB Lung Cancer AJCC v8, Stage IIIC Lung Cancer AJCC v8, Stage IV Lung Cancer AJCC v8, Stage IVA Lung Cancer AJCC v8, Stage IVB Lung Cancer AJCC v8

In brief

This clinical trial focuses on a nurse-led program that is designed to help patients cope with worries, fears, and uncertainty about the future. The purpose of this study is to understand if the program is helpful and practical to carry out at medical centers and community clinics. This study may help patients learn more effective ways to cope and respond to your concerns and any unhelpful thoughts.
